Eligibility Essentials
Ask SPH Media for current criteria; historically these include:
- Strong pre-university or polytechnic results
- Leadership/CCA track record and character references
- Demonstrable journalism or content creation skills and current affairs interest
- Language proficiency (English and/or mother tongue); check if Malaysian citizens remain eligible for Chinese Media Group tracks
Application Timeline
- Oct–Dec: Compile writing samples, multimedia projects, and referee letters; attend SPH Media scholarship briefings.
- Jan: Submit application (even before final exam results) with transcripts, essays, and evidence of journalistic aptitude.
- Feb: Complete aptitude tests covering language proficiency, situational judgment, and current affairs IQ.
- Mar: Attend panel interviews with newsroom editors who evaluate news instincts and resilience.
- Apr–May: Receive outcomes; prepare for internship placements and scholar induction.
